musical theatre in and aroundNew York City andPhiladelphia . While living in New York, she began forming ideas about jazz singing. After moving to Austin, Marsh attended concerts byAnthony Braxton andSam Rivers atArmadillo World Headquarters . These performances inspired her to form her first professional group, New Visions Ensemble, with Alex Coke, Rock Savage, Booka Michel and Horatio Rodriguez.In 1980, at the suggestion of
Charlie Haden , Marsh studied at theCreative Music Studio inWoodstock, New York . Upon returning to Austin, she formed the Creative Opportunity Orchestra with the members of New Visions Ensemble at its core. CO2 began as acooperative organization, similar to the AACM, though Marsh gradually assumed a managerial role and became the group's director.Marsh and CO2 have gone on to perform with artists such as
Carla Bley ,Hamiett Bluiett ,Vinny Golia ,Dennis González ,Billy Hart ,Roscoe Mitchell ,Steve Swallow , andKenny Wheeler . The ensemble regularly performs at theLaguna Gloria lakeside amphitheater in Austin.
